Born 2000 Foshan, China
Liang He is a
research-based interdisciplinary artist and a gamer who explores games and
play, and systems associated with the construction of identities. His sculpture
and installation works are playful recreations of the artists’ daily encounters or
fictional scenarios. They merge his interests towards historical narratives,
video games, pop culture and media technology, and illuminate existing systems
or narrative. Through creating these game-like installations, he often embark on
a research journey, where he is able to experiment and rhetorically reconfigure
the dynamics within the systems or narratives being referred to.
